ExxonMobil’s affiliates in India
ExxonMobil’s affiliates have offices in India in Bengaluru, Mumbai and the National Capital Region.
ExxonMobil’s affiliates in India supporting the Product Solutions business engage in the marketing, sales and distribution of performance as well as specialty products across chemicals and lubricants businesses. The India planning teams are also embedded with global business units for business planning and analytics.
ExxonMobil’s LNG affiliate in India supporting the upstream business provides consultant services for other ExxonMobil upstream affiliates and conducts LNG market-development activities.
The Global Business Center - Technology Center provides a range of technical and business support services for ExxonMobil’s operations around the globe.

What Role You Will Play In Our Team Reporting within the Upstream Strategy and Business Development organization, you will have the opportunity to contribute your competitive intelligence expertise to a range of upstream businesses and projects. These may include strategies and specific commercial opportunities supporting exploration, existing operations, power development and other general Upstream opportunities. As an Upstream Competitive Intelligence Advisor you will be a key ambassador for strategy and competitive intelligence practices within the corporation. You will serve as a hub of information, combining technical and financial inputs to generate actionable insights that drive and influence major decisions.
What You Will Do
Distinguish key competitors and monitor developments to stay informed of market changes and ahead of potential competitor actions.
Synthesize intelligence from various sources to triangulate insights on industry trends, competitor strategies, and market dynamics or signposts.
Leverage analysis to then generate actionable insights that enable Upstream opportunities, spanning new projects, exploration, M&A, etc., consistent with long-term strategies and objectives.
Identify, develop, and maintain products and tools that improve dissemination of intelligence insights to broader organization.
Ensure consistency and completeness of approach, accuracy of findings, objectivity, and corporate general interest focus when producing intelligence content.
Contribute as member of an integrated business team responsible for owning competitive intelligence processes, tools, and resulting products. Requires cross functional collaboration and ability to identify impactful insights for opportunities.
